Georgia - Commercial and Public Services Final Consumption of Anthracite

Since 2014, Georgia Commercial and Public Services Final Consumption of Anthracite fell by 100%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 7 comparing other countries in Commercial and Public Services Final Consumption of Anthracite at 0 Thousand Metric Tons. Moldova lead the ranking with 26 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, -7.1% versus 2018. Ukraine, France and Albania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Albania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+3.9% per year, while Georgia wit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
